Types of Pushchairs
Pushchairs come in various sizes and shapes, each designed for various requirements and way of lives. Understanding the types offered will make it much easier for moms and dads to figure out the best option for their specific requirements.

1. Umbrella Pushchairs
- Description: Lightweight and easy to fold, these pushchairs are ideal for moms and dads on the go.
- Pros:
- Compact and portable
- Budget-friendly
- Cons:
- Limited features
- May do not have durability for everyday use
2. Travel Systems
- Description: This type integrates an infant cars and truck seat with a pushchair, permitting seamless transitions from automobile to stroller.
- Pros:
- Versatile and convenient
- Economic alternative for newborns
- Cons:
- Potentially bulkier than umbrella pushchairs
3. Convertible Pushchairs
- Description: Pram sale These can easily change in between carrying a single kid or accommodating two.
- Pros:
- Adaptable as the family grows
- Offers several setups
- Cons:
- Can be more costly
- Some designs can be heavy
4. All-Terrain pushchairs Best
- Description: Designed for use on different terrains, these pushchairs are best for active families.
- Pros:
- Sturdy for outside experiences
- Exceptional suspension systems
- Cons:
- Heavier and more cumbersome
- Generally pricier
Secret Features to Consider
When picking the best pushchair, moms and dads ought to keep numerous functions in mind to make sure functionality, security, and convenience. The following table lays out critical considerations relating to features:
| Feature | Description | Considerations |
|---|---|---|
| Safety Harness | A five-point harness keeps the kid secure. | Guarantee it is adjustable as they grow. |
| Foldability | Easy-to-use fold mechanism for storage and portability. | Think about how compactly it folds. |
| Weight | Lighter pushchairs are simpler to navigate. | Balance weight with sturdiness. |
| Recline Position | Multi-position reclining for convenience during naps. | Look for adjustable backrest angles. |
| Storage Basket | Ample storage for bags and basics | Ensure easy gain access to while walking. |
| Canopy Size | Offers sun security and shade | Validate UV security features. |
Comfort for the Child
The convenience of the kid is critical when considering a pushchair. Here are some features that boost comfort:
- Seat Padding: Look for well-padded seats to offer comfort throughout long outings.
- Suspension System: A good suspension system soaks up shocks from irregular surfaces.
- Canopy with UV Protection: Offers shade and safeguards the child from hazardous rays.

FAQs
Q1: What age can a baby start utilizing a pushchair?
Most cheap pushchairs are created for babies aged three months and older; nevertheless, some travel systems accommodate newborns in a lying position.
Q2: Can a pushchair be utilized for jogging?
Only particular designs labeled as "running pushchairs" must be used for jogging due to their improved stability and suspension systems.
Q3: How do I maintain my pushchair?
Regular cleansing, oiling wheels, and examining the harness system are essential for maintaining a pushchair in good condition.
Q4: Is a heavier pushchair better?
A heavier pushchair typically signifies toughness, however it might likewise be troublesome. It is essential to find a balance based upon your lifestyle needs.
Q5: Are all pushchairs foldable?
The majority of pushchairs are designed to fold, but the degree of ease and density might differ. Always evaluate the folding mechanism before purchase.
